Located in the Mississippi Flyway and sitting on the banks of Overflow National Wildlife Refuge is Overflow Lodge, home to CDF guests. Here we offer the works; Imagine a plantation landscape surrounded by Bayou Bartholomew in front and Walker Break in the rear yard. The recreation of this antebellum plantation home was built in 1979 and is located on twelve acres of live oak trees, long leaf pines, magnolia and cypress trees. The plantation home is colonial in style and is the perfect spot to rest, relax, and experience a trip back in time!
We offer a variety of habitats to hunt but our most dominant and plentiful are our rice fields, covering some 4,000 acres of prime waterfowl real estate. Our fields sit between the Worlds Longest Bayou, Bayou Bartholomew and the Mighty Mississippi River, each within 15 minutes of our ground. These two water passages are major flyway routes for thousands of mallards and multiple species of birds every winter during migration!
